Pine Island

The first icon you come to is the Matlacha Bridge. One of Florida's most fished bridges. It is the link from the main land of Cape Coral to the barrier islands of Pine Island Sound. Matlacha has changed it's characteristics from a fishing village to an artist community. The once fish homes that have been the main focus on the the only main road to Pine Island, now are all revitilaized and serving as the decorative and colorful artisian homes with thriving business, unique shops and eateries. The colorful transition have giving it a  look similar to Key West but right in our backyard. Pine Island is home to not only some of the best back water fishing spots in the entire US, it is also home to several exotic fruit and vegetable farmers. The the warm weather and tempraturs never reaching freezing it has been the perfect environment for these farmers to produce some of the best mangos and other exotic fruits that are shipped all over the world. Pine island still is one of the unspoiled comunities Lee County has within it's limits. The abundant wild life will take you back to a day the once existed in our area, where you can hike some of the oldest indian villages in Florida. Yet minutes away there are some of the states largest shrimp, and crab fisheries going on. These parts have a great combination of farms to waterfront homes in paradise to choose from.
